    This is one of those instances where half-stars would have come in handy as I would have scored Japan Express as a "3.5." However, I should point out that I've only used their drive thru services. Japan Express is located in a free-standing fast-food type building (I think it was a KFC in a former life) and they offer habachi-type as well as sushi fare and I've tried both. The habachi food (I tried the chicken entree) is just "okay," but the price is good for the large amount of food you get. The sushi (I should mention here that I don't eat seafood) comes as 8 pieces per roll. I usually order the vegetable roll - avocado and cucumber - as well as the chicken tempura roll (which has cream cheese in addition to the tempura chicken). I liked both rolls well enough to keep going back to Japan Express (plus, I'm lazy and the drive thru option is highly appealing to us lazy folk). Regarding the drive thru option - be prepared to wait 10 or 15 minutes for your order. I don't mind this now that I know this is the norm, but the first few times this happened, I was very impatient (and hungry). Also, no matter which staff member is manning the drive thru, their affect is pretty flat and there's no friendliness. They're not rude by any means, just kind of emotionless. At any rate, I'll continue to patron Japan Express because 1) they're close to my house, 2) the food is okay and 3) I'm laz so drive thru is appealing.

    This place is great for a quick sashimi fix for me and my daughter without spending lavishly. I get the #17 (16 pcs sashimi combo includes soup) and share it with my daughter and get my son the #77 (gyoza/dumplings) all for $20 lunch. That's not bad for the 3 of us considering a light lunch, that includes fresh fish. We come here often as it is close by our house. The owners are familiar with us so it's nice to see smiling faces serve you. Lunch specials for sushi and hibachi are great and cheap for serving size and meats. They serve pretty fast too, so if you're pressed for time, try it out.

Overall good restaurant, particularly the food and value, but the front-of-house experience needs improvement. I would probably stop by again, especially because the Salmon Teriyaki Bento was really tasty. Food: 4 out of 5 First time here I ordered the Fish Tempura roll, the Avocado roll, and the Krab Blossoms. The Fish Tempura roll was tasty and the Krab Blossoms were hot and fresh - The sesame sauce that came with them was phenomenal. The avocado roll was underwhelming, but I believe it was because of the rice. It wasn't seasoned properly IMO. My second time I ordered the Krab Blossoms again and the Salmon Teriyaki Bento for dinner. The bento came with SO much stuff, I had leftovers for lunch the next day. It was flavorful and delicious. Highly recommend this dish. Hospitality: 2.5 out of 5 Honestly a miss. Not sure if it's because we ordered takeout both times, but the FOH staff working was not particularly friendly or welcoming. They gave the impression that they didn't care if we ordered there or not. I tipped on my first order (compulsory) but the next time I didn't. I'm just happy my order was correct. Value: 4 out of 5 Their menu has a bit of everything, from hand rolls, to sushi/sashimi, special rolls, hibachi, bento boxes, noodles, appetizers, and even kids meals. Prices ranges from 6.95 (the lowest priced roll) to 17.95 (the highest priced specialty roll) highest hibachi grill entree is 23.95 for dinner, the lowest is 16.95 (or 15.75 if you just want veggies). I say all of this to say it's not especially inexpensive, but there's a wide range of what you can enjoy here. If you're on a budget, you should stop by for lunch because your dollars will go a lot further. Parking: 4 out of 5 A few spaces available in the front. I saw a sign that indicated there was additional parking on the side of the restaurant.
